Havant Borough Council recently took the decision to close the visitor information centre at Beachlands during weekends a situation that has prompted wide criticism. HBC defended their action stating that fewer customers used the information centre during Saturdays and Sundays last year. Dawn Adey marketing and customer relations service manager said: Weekend opening hours have changed as we were experiencing low attendance at weekends during 2013.
Marshall Hill one of Funland Amusement Parks owners criticised the new timetable with comments published in the Hayling Islander: Its ridiculous to stop providing visitor information at weekends. If the council needs to save money the centre should be closed at quiet times not during busy weekends in the tourist season. Hayling Seaside Railways Bob Hancock also added: We should support the tourist industry which brings about 60m per year into the borough.
Councillor Andy Lenaghan said a meeting has been arranged after Haylings Conservatives voiced concerns over the new opening hours.
Peak season opening hours are Monday to Friday 9am-5pm and closed Saturdays Sundays and bank holidays. July 28-Spetmeber 6 will see the office open from 9am until noon on Saturday.
